Bo la lot is a Vietnamese dish of minced beef, wrapped in piper lolot leaves, then grilled over charcoal. Fully known as thit bo nuong la lot (thịt bò nướng lá lốt), this Vietnamese dish includes minced beef mixed with garlic and shallots and some simple spices, wrapped into wild betel leaves. Eating good food is key to cooking good food, so I have been looking for the. When wrapped in la lot leaves, the beef filling will be lightly infused with a mild peppery fragrance. Many restaurants outside of Vietnam translate la lot as betel leaves and call the dish grilled beef in betel leaves, thus get people confused.
